Do you have an eToken? You need to put a private key and cert on the
token. This is now described here:

http://openvpn.net/index.php/open-source/documentation/howto.html#pkcs11

When I originally prepared my eToken, I created the PKCS12 file with
easy-rsa, initialized the token with pkcs15-init and put the PKCS12 file
on the token with pkcs15-init.

I'm not sure if the hang is also reproducable with a token without
PKCS15 structure on it.

It should also be possible to use Aladdins proprietary PKCS11 provider
under linux, but I never tried that. I can try some other eTokens with
Aladdins file structure and see what happens with opevpn
--show-pkcs11-ids in Ubuntu 10.10 and 11.04. (Openvpn worked for me in
10.10)
